Flush Bracket G582: Sanquhar ,Town Hall   

Photo on OSBM
S face, SE angle of building, junction of Church Road, Sanquhar - Town Hall.

Location
Grid reference: NS 7805 0992.
Landranger 71: Lanark & Upper Nithsdale.
Landranger 78: Nithsdale & Annandale, Sanquhar & Moffat.
Structure: Village / Town hall.
Waypoint: FBG582.

Second Geodetic Levelling, Scotland (1936-52)
This flush bracket was used during the Second geodetic levelling, Scotland, and was levelled with a height of 470.9000 feet [143.5303 metres] above mean sea level (Newlyn datum). It was included on the Carronbridge to New Cumnock levelling line. The surveyor's description was S face, SE angle of building, junction of Church Road, Sanquhar.

Third Geodetic Levelling, Scotland (1956-68)
This flush bracket was used during the Third geodetic levelling, Scotland. It was included on the Elvanfoot to New Cumnock levelling line.
